You can make exceptions to the unsafe-file list:
a.. Navigate to:
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Internet
Explorer\UnsafeFiles\Exclude
You will have to create the key if it does not exist. It won't.
b.. From the Edit menu, select New, Key
c.. Enter the extension you want to exclude
for example to exclude .exe from the default list, add it:
.exe
